in law, words are everything—every comma, every clause, every nuance matters. And yet when it comes to feedback? I’ll spend days on a memo or motion and get a single “fine” or “thanks.” No context, no direction, no idea if I nailed it or totally missed the mark. I want to get better, but it feels impossible to grow when no one takes the time to actually tell you what you’re doing well or where you need to improve. How are we supposed to develop in this vacuum?

You may get more traction asking for advice rather than feedback. Weird little mental trick that seems to make a big difference. So instead of “please let me know if there is feedback on the draft attached” try “attached is the draft. I would appreciate any advice on how I could improve it.”

It’s frustrating, but sadly common. Try asking for specific feedback on one aspect instead of a general “how was it?” You might get more helpful insights when you guide the conversation.

The absence of criticism is approval. If you’re not getting edits, you’re doing well. Positive feedback in this field is rare.

like

Exactly. It’s not as though the partner is saying, “This is a really mediocre brief but I’ll sign my name to it anyway.”

Common. But it also depends who you work with. If you’re getting 0 feedback from anyone at your firm then it might be a systematic issue you can’t fix. If you can live with it, then it is what it is. If it’s a dealbreaker then you should look to move.
